This promo is a considerable savings for out family; however, it was my understanding that if you price match to this sort of promo, you lose your room and Carnival gets to pick a new one for you. We like our Empress Deck, Midship location and have family in the interior across the hall....

 

I would love to call up my TA and turn in a price protection form, but do not want to lose my room. Would I be able to price match AND keep my room???

 

Thanks!

Sara

 

Not true!!!!!

They have TWO different ones:

1. Carnival Picks your room

2. You keep your cabin

 

We kept our cabin and saved $520:D:D:D

I checked fare viewer and saw that the price dropped $130 for July 6th on the Pride. Called Carnival to get the adjustment and was told that if I switched to this rate I would lose my current $150 OBC that I got when I booked originally.

 

Wasn't worth it as I would end up being out $20 if I changed. Sucks, but I'll keep checking for drops.
